    the only way to *truly* get rid of it is to buy some biological enzyme cleaning spray stuff from a vets, because it breaks down everything rather than just masking it. It also stops the dog being attracted to going there again (which, even if you cant smell it the dog will be able to)

    Although, if you dont want to be buying stuff like that, im guessing the next best thing would be some biological washing powder. Mix up a solution and soak the area, but dont let it dry for a day or so, keep it moist by spraying with more water, and then wash the soap out and let dry.
